Qutayba Hamid
About
Qutayba Hamid has authored 493 papers that have received a total of 35.9k indexed citations.
This includes 337 papers in Physiology, 184 papers in Immunology and 138 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. The topics of these papers are Asthma and respiratory diseases (327 papers), IL-33, ST2, and ILC Pathways (95 papers) and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(93 papers). Qutayba Hamid is often cited by papers focused on Asthma and respiratory diseases (327 papers), IL-33, ST2, and ILC Pathways (95 papers) and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(93 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United Arab Emirates and United States. Qutayba Hamid's co-authors include James G. Martin, David H. Eidelman, Rame Taha, Stephen R. Durham and Rabih Halwani and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, New England Journal of Medicine and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ences.
